North College Hill
Excel Screen Printing
Ten miles north of downtown Cincinnati, North College Hill features streets lined with quaint bungalows built in the 1940s and a newly remodeled public high school. The neighborhood is home to Cary Cottage - childhood home of famous poets Alice and Phoebe Cary and later became the first home for blind women in the state of Ohio. Now Clovernook Center for the Blind and Visually Impaired, the organization is one of the world's largest producers of Braille publications.
